Continue readingAn excellent comparison of the state-of-the-art cell segmentation methods for label-free microscopy has been lately done by scientists of Masaryk University.
With the Dice coefficient of 0.82, the all-in-one dry mass guided watershed algorithm (aioDMGW) implemented in Q-PHASE software was evaluated as one of the two best-performing algorithms for label-free cell segmentation. The algorithm is based on quantitative phase imaging QPI, which is an emerging imaging method stated by the study like the one providing the highest segmentation efficiency and throughput.

Q-PHASE is a unique instrument for quantitative phase imaging (QPI) based on the patented coherence-controlled holographic microscopy technology. CODIM is an outstanding technology, backed by a vast patent portfolio, that transforms any fluorescence microscope into a high-end super-resolution microscopy solution.
